CACI Awarded $34 Million Contract to Continue Implementing Financial Management Solution for Defense Agencies Initiative

CACI International Inc (NYSE MKT: CACI) announced today that it has been awarded a $34 million prime contract to continue implementing a federal financial management and accounting solution as part of the Defense Agencies Initiative (DAI). This three-year contract represents ongoing business in CACI’s Business Systems market area.

DAI is a critical Department of Defense (DoD) effort to transform the budget, finance, and accounting operations of most DoD defense agencies. Under this contract, CACI will implement an Oracle® enterprise resource planning solution to standardize federal financial management and accounting systems and ensure compliance with federal and DoD financial management regulations and policies. This solution will consolidate multiple legacy systems into a single platform, and will be used by numerous agencies across DoD.
